Management's Agentic Crowdy Studio policy publication. EFFECTIVE values are the fail-closed platform/app intersection; an app can never widen platform models, tools, modes, risks, budgets, retention, or privacy. Game API runtime enforcement still requires a fresh validated replica.

Fields

CrowdyStudioAgentPolicy.kind ● CrowdyStudioAgentPolicyKind! non-null enum

PLATFORM, APP, or EFFECTIVE projection.

CrowdyStudioAgentPolicy.appId ● BigInt scalar

App id for APP/EFFECTIVE policy; null for platform policy.

CrowdyStudioAgentPolicy.enabled ● Boolean! non-null scalar

Whether this Management policy layer/publication is enabled. EFFECTIVE is true only when all required layers are enabled and no kill applies; it does not attest that Game API has synchronized.

CrowdyStudioAgentPolicy.killSwitch ● Boolean! non-null scalar

Layer kill state. EFFECTIVE is true when platform, operator-app, or app kill is active.

CrowdyStudioAgentPolicy.operatorKillSwitch ● Boolean! non-null scalar

Operator-only per-app kill state. App policy mutations cannot clear or alter it.

CrowdyStudioAgentPolicy.disableReasonCode ● String scalar

Stable disable/kill reason code (for example AGENT_OPERATOR_KILLED); null when enabled.

CrowdyStudioAgentPolicy.disableReason ● String scalar

Safe operator/app reason text; never includes provider bodies or secrets.

CrowdyStudioAgentPolicy.allowedModelIds ● [String!]! non-null scalar

Exact model ids allowed by this layer/intersection. Empty denies all models.

CrowdyStudioAgentPolicy.allowedToolNames ● [String!]! non-null scalar

Exact crowdy.agent-tools/1 logical tool names allowed by this layer/intersection. Empty means opposite things at the two layers: on PLATFORM it denies every tool, because the platform layer is the ceiling; on APP it expresses no narrowing, so EFFECTIVE inherits the platform list unchanged. An app therefore cannot reach a tool the platform has not published, and an operator who later adds one widens every app that names none.

CrowdyStudioAgentPolicy.allowedModes ● [CrowdyStudioAgentMode!]! non-null enum

Human-selectable modes allowed by this layer/intersection.

CrowdyStudioAgentPolicy.allowedRiskClasses ● [CrowdyStudioAgentRiskClass!]! non-null enum

Allowed tool risk classes. Required approval classes remain approval-gated even when listed. Empty follows the same rule as allowedToolNames: deny-all on PLATFORM, inherit-the-platform on APP. An EFFECTIVE policy can never be enabled with an empty list, because crowdy.studio-agent-policy/1 requires a non-empty risk intersection; that case reports AGENT_SCOPE_DENIED.

CrowdyStudioAgentPolicy.capabilityGaps ● [CrowdyStudioAgentCapabilityGap!]! non-null object

Allowed modes that cannot do what the mode is for, derived from this layer's own tool and risk allowlists. Read this on the EFFECTIVE projection: an empty list is the only thing that entitles a caller to report an unblocked chain, because "enabled with a null disableReasonCode" is true of a dock whose BUILD mode has no tool it may call. On PLATFORM and APP it describes that layer in isolation and is not a claim about the intersection.

CrowdyStudioAgentPolicy.revision ● BigInt! non-null scalar

Revision of this stored layer; zero means no app row exists yet.

CrowdyStudioAgentPolicy.platformRevision ● BigInt! non-null scalar

Platform revision used by an EFFECTIVE projection.

CrowdyStudioAgentPolicy.appRevision ● BigInt! non-null scalar

App revision used by an EFFECTIVE projection; zero means missing app policy.

CrowdyStudioAgentPolicy.effectiveRevision ● String! non-null scalar

Composite Management revision, formatted p<platform revision>:a<app revision>. Game API pins it only after a successful fresh replica pull.
